首页 | 本学科首页   官方微博 | 高级检索  
     

MPI+OpenMP混合编程模型在大规模三对角线性方程组求解中的应用
引用本文:郑汉垣,刘智翔,封卫兵,张武.MPI+OpenMP混合编程模型在大规模三对角线性方程组求解中的应用[J].微电子学与计算机,2011,28(8).
作者姓名:郑汉垣  刘智翔  封卫兵  张武
作者单位:1. 上海大学计算机工程与科学学院,上海200072/龙岩学院计算机系,福建龙岩364000
2. 上海大学计算机工程与科学学院,上海,200072
基金项目:上海市科委重点项目(10510500600); 教育部2008年度高等学校博士学科点专项科研基金项目(200802800007); 上海市重点学科建设项目资助基金项目(J50103)
摘    要:分布式共享存储系统的特点是每个节点内是共享存储的,而节点间是分布式存储.为了更好地利用这种多级体系结构,讨论了MPI+OpenMP混合编程模型的性能及实现方法,建立了大规模三对角线性方程组的MPI+OpenMP混合并行算法,并在上海大学高性能计算集群上与单纯MPI算法进行了性能方面的比较.结果表明,MPI+OpenMP混合并行算法具有更好的加速比和扩展性.

关 键 词:混合编程模型  分布共享存储  三对角线性方程组  MPI

MPI and OpenMP Paradigms and Its Application of Solving Large Scale Tridiagonal Linear Systems
ZHENG Han-yuan,LIU Zhi-xiang,FENG Wei-bing,ZHANG Wu.MPI and OpenMP Paradigms and Its Application of Solving Large Scale Tridiagonal Linear Systems[J].Microelectronics & Computer,2011,28(8).
Authors:ZHENG Han-yuan    LIU Zhi-xiang  FENG Wei-bing  ZHANG Wu
Affiliation:ZHENG Han-yuan1,2,LIU Zhi-xiang1,FENG Wei-bing1,ZHANG Wu1(1 School of Computer Science,Shanghai University,Shanghai 200072,China,2 Department of Computer,Longyan University,Lingyan 364000,China)
Abstract:The distributed shared memory system is characterized by shared memory multi-processors on each node and distributed memory among nodes.In order to make use of this hierarchical architecture,this paper discusses the performance of MPI+OpenMP hybrid programming paradigm and different implementations.We design a multi-granularity parallel algorithm for solving larger scale tridiagonal linear systems,and compare its performance with pure MPI algorithm on the high performance computer of Shanghai University.The...
Keywords:hybrid paradigm  distributed shared memory  tridiagonal linear systems  MPI  
本文献已被 CNKI 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号